Obama meets Bush at White House for 2 hours

Comments 0 | Recommend 0

The Associated Press

WASHINGTON - President-elect Obama and President Bush have completed their private meeting at the White House.

Neither the incoming nor the current president spoke to reporters at Obama's arrival or departure Monday afternoon.

Obama is leaving the mansion in their motorcade after he and his wife, Michelle, offered a symbolic glimpse of the new first family and administration that take office in January. Bush walked Obama to his limousine as he left.

The Obamas spent just under two hours at the White House.

Bush and Obama held their first-ever face-to-face session in the Oval Office. It was Obama's first visit to the Oval Office. First lady Laura Bush and Michelle Obama held their own meeting in the White House residence.
